首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

phpstudy mysql忘记密码

基础概念

phpstudy 是一个集成了 Apache、Nginx、MySQL、PHP 等多个组件的集成环境,常用于快速搭建本地 Web 开发环境。MySQL 是一个关系型数据库管理系统,用于存储和管理数据。

忘记 MySQL 密码的处理方法

当忘记 MySQL 的 root 用户密码时,可以通过以下步骤重置密码:

1. 停止 MySQL 服务

phpstudy 控制面板中,停止 MySQL 服务。

2. 编辑配置文件

找到 MySQL 的配置文件 my.ini(通常位于 phpstudy 安装目录下的 mysql 文件夹中),在 [mysqld] 部分添加以下内容:

代码语言:txt
复制
skip-grant-tables

保存并关闭文件。

3. 启动 MySQL 服务

重新启动 MySQL 服务。

4. 登录 MySQL

打开命令行工具,输入以下命令登录 MySQL:

代码语言:txt
复制
mysql -u root

此时不需要输入密码即可登录。

5. 重置密码

在 MySQL 命令行中,执行以下命令重置 root 用户的密码:

代码语言:txt
复制
UPDATE mysql.user SET Password=PASSWORD('new_password') WHERE User='root';
FLUSH PRIVILEGES;

new_password 替换为你想要设置的新密码。

6. 撤销配置修改

退出 MySQL 命令行,编辑 my.ini 文件,删除之前添加的 skip-grant-tables 行,保存并关闭文件。

7. 重启 MySQL 服务

重新启动 MySQL 服务。

应用场景

这种方法适用于在本地开发环境中忘记 MySQL 密码的情况。通过上述步骤,可以快速重置密码,恢复数据库的正常访问。

参考链接

如果你在使用腾讯云的云数据库 MySQL,可以通过腾讯云控制台重置密码,具体操作可以参考:

希望这些信息对你有所帮助!

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券